Rather than doing a dump from the NAND, go to the source of where you got most of them, your game discs. They are already in WAD format, and you can dump them from disc to SD using a utility called WUFE.

Yeah IOS don't change with systemmenu menus, only the systemmenu IOS changes. Every once in awhile they'll add new IOS's with updates but they don't usually change them and haven't changed them yet.
rather than extracting the ios files from the disk you can extract them from partion 1 of the iso file with wii scrubber.
ios's arent different for each system menu and firmware.
in other words you can extract an ios from a game with ancient firmware eg. paper mario and install it on a wii with firmware 3.2 and it would work perfectly

The best ones are ones that is trucha-bugged.
The reason you got different version of IOSes is because they are from different discs, thus, they are from different updates, thus, one is lower version one is higher.
Just install either one of those two, and have a run of IOS Downgrader.
